What makes sound patterns expressive? : the poetic mode of speech perception is a book. It was written by Reuven Tsur and published by Duke University Press in 1992.
Key facts
- author: Reuven Tsur
- publication date: 1992
- book publisher: Duke University Press
- book series: Sound and meaning
- book subjects: Sound symbolism, Speech perception, Versification
